Cooling device for processing fried convenient wonton
Technical Field
The utility model relates to a food processing technology field especially relates to a cooling device is used in processing of fried convenient wonton.
Background
With the pace of life acceleration, the eating habits of people also start to change, and because work or study is busy and no time is available for carefully eating one meal, fast food is often selected to solve three meals, and the fast food times are silent.
In the production and preparation process of fried convenient wonton, need cool off the wonton so that preserve after the frying, the conventionality is to put into the cooling box with whole dish wonton and cool off, refrigerated main part is exactly the condenser pipe in the cooling box, and the condenser pipe can form the water droplet at its outer wall after long-time the use, and final amasss in a lot and piles up in the incasement, can cause the influence to the operation of machine after ponding is too much, therefore need a device to solve the problem urgently.
SUMMERY OF THE UTILITY MODEL
The utility model aims at solving the problem that the condensed water produced by the condensing tube in the cooling box in the prior art is piled up and is difficult to clean, and providing a cooling device for processing the fried convenient wonton.

Preferably, the side walls of the two sides of the cooling box are both provided with sliding grooves, and the box door slides and is arranged on one side of the sliding grooves.
Preferably, the conducting bars are welded on the inner walls of the two sides of the cooling box, the guide grooves are formed in the two ends of the placing frame, and the guide grooves are matched with the conducting bars.
Preferably, the fixing plate is of a cavity structure, and the upper surface of the fixing plate is of a mesh structure.
Preferably, the rotating plate and the mounting seat are fixedly connected through a fixed shaft, and the tilt sensor is embedded in the outer wall of the rotating plate.
Preferably, the linkage rod is fixed on the side wall of the floating block through a key pin, and the linkage rod is connected and fixed with the side wall of the rotating plate through the key pin.
Preferably, the indicator light is connected with the inclination angle sensor through an electric signal.
The utility model discloses a set up the water catch bowl in the bottom of condenser pipe, utilize the water catch bowl to collect the produced comdenstion water of condenser pipe, simultaneously, set up the water level monitoring mechanism who comprises kicking block, gangbar and commentaries on classics board etc. in the water catch bowl to this ponding condition in the monitoring water catch bowl is compared in prior art, the utility model discloses can concentrate the produced comdenstion water of condenser pipe and collect, but also can be according to what of ponding come to carry out timely processing to it.
Drawings
FIG. 1 is a schematic structural view of a cooling device for processing fried instant wonton of the utility model;
fig. 2 is a schematic view of a local structure a of the cooling device for processing fried instant wonton of the utility model.
In the figure: 1 box door, 2 cooling boxes, 21 placing frames, 22 sliding grooves, 23 fixing plates, 3 condensation pipe groups, 4 water collecting grooves, 41 mounting seats, 42 guide shafts, 5 rotating plates, 51 tilt angle sensors, 6 floating blocks and 7 linkage rods.

Referring to fig. 1-2, a cooling device for processing fried convenient wonton, which comprises a box door 1 and a cooling box 2, wherein the side walls of the two sides of the cooling box 2 are both provided with a chute 22, the box door 1 is arranged at one side of the chute 22 in a sliding manner, the side wall of the cooling box 2 is embedded with an indicator lamp (the indicator lamp is connected with an inclination angle sensor 51 through an electric signal), the indicator lamp is used for reminding when excessive water is accumulated conveniently, a placing frame 21 is placed between the inner walls of the cooling box 2, the placing frame 21 is used for placing food, guide bars are welded on the inner walls of the two sides of the cooling box 2, two ends of the placing frame 21 are both provided with guide grooves, the guide bars and the guide grooves are used for fixing the placing frame 21, the guide grooves and the guide bars are mutually matched, a fixing plate 23 is also welded between the inner walls of the cooling box 2, the fixing plate 23 is in, the purpose of condenser bank 3 is to refrigerate the interior of cooling box 1, and the bottom of fixed plate 23 is provided with a water collecting tank 4 with a water outlet (the water outlet is plugged with a plug), the water collecting tank 4 is used for collecting condensed water produced by condenser bank 3, a sewer pipe is connected between fixed plate 23 and water collecting tank 4, a mounting seat 41 is welded on one side inner wall of water collecting tank 4, a rotating plate 5 with a built-in tilt sensor 51 (the tilt sensor 51 is SWK6-QJ02-001) is installed on one side of mounting seat 41, a rotating handle 5 is used for assisting in monitoring the water level in water collecting tank 4, a guide shaft 42 is arranged at the bottom of mounting seat 41, the guide shaft 42 is used for guiding a floating block 6, the outer wall of guide shaft 42 is provided with a floating block 6 in a sliding manner (the density of floating block 6 is less than that of water), the floating block 6 is used for driving rotating plate 5 to rotate, and the floating block 6 and rotating plate 5 are connected.
Wherein, it is fixed to pass through fixed axle connection between commentaries on classics board 5 and the mount pad 41, and inclination sensor 51 inlays in the outer wall of commentaries on classics board 5, and inclination sensor 51 is for the inclination between monitoring commentaries on classics board 5 and the horizontal plane to control the pilot lamp scintillation, and, the gangbar 7 is fixed in the lateral wall of floating block 6 through the key pin, and also is fixed through the key pin connection between the gangbar 7 and the lateral wall of commentaries on classics board 5.
In the embodiment, the box door 1 is moved upwards, then the guide groove of the placing frame 21 is aligned with the guide strip, the placing frame 21 is plugged in, food is placed on the placing frame 21, the box door 1 is moved downwards to seal the cooling box 2, the condensation pipe group 3 gradually generates water drops on the outer wall of the condensation pipe group along with the extension of cooling time, the water drops drop falls into the fixed plate 23, finally the water drops accumulated together fall into the water collecting tank 4 along the sewer pipes from the outlets at two sides, the floating block 6 is floated upwards along the guide shaft 42 under the buoyancy of water along with the gradual increase of the falling water in the water collecting tank 4, the linkage rod 7 moves along with the water drops in the upward moving process of the floating block 6, so that the rotating plate 5 is pushed upwards by the end of the linkage rod 7 connected with the rotating plate 5, the angle of the inclination angle sensor 51 begins to change in the upward rotating process of the rotating plate 5, when the angle monitored by the inclination angle sensor 51 is 0 degree (namely, the rotating plate 5, at the moment, the inclination angle sensor 51 sends a signal to control the indicator light to flash, after the staff sees the signal, the door 1 is moved upwards, after the cooling box 2 is exposed, the blockage of the outer wall of the water collecting tank 4 is taken out, the water in the water collecting tank 4 is discharged and then is plugged back, and then the door 1 is moved back to continue cooling.

Claims (7)

1. A cooling device for processing fried convenient wonton comprises a box door (1) and a cooling box (2), wherein the box door (1) is arranged on the side wall of the cooling box (2) in a sliding mode, an indicator lamp is embedded in the side wall of the cooling box (2), the cooling device is characterized in that a placing frame (21) is placed between the inner walls of the cooling box (2), a fixing plate (23) is welded between the inner walls of the cooling box (2), a condensation pipe group (3) is arranged inside the fixing plate (23), a water collecting tank (4) with a water outlet is arranged at the bottom of the fixing plate (23), a sewer pipe is connected between the fixing plate (23) and the water collecting tank (4), a mounting seat (41) is welded on the inner wall of one side of the water collecting tank (4), a rotating plate (5) with a built-in inclination angle sensor (51) is installed on one side of the mounting seat (41), a guide shaft (42) is arranged at the bottom of the mounting seat (41), a floating, the floating block (6) and the rotating plate (5) are fixedly connected through a linkage rod (7).
2. The cooling device for processing the fried instant wonton according to claim 1, wherein sliding grooves (22) are formed in the side walls of two sides of the cooling box (2), and the box door (1) is slidably arranged on one side of the sliding grooves (22).
3. The cooling device for processing the fried instant wonton according to claim 1, wherein guide bars are welded on the inner walls of two sides of the cooling box (2), guide grooves are formed in two ends of the placing frame (21), and the guide grooves are matched with the guide bars.
4. The cooling device for fried instant wonton processing according to claim 1, wherein the fixing plate (23) is of a cavity structure, and the upper surface of the fixing plate (23) is of a mesh structure.
5. The cooling device for fried instant wonton processing according to claim 1, wherein the rotating plate (5) is fixedly connected with the mounting seat (41) through a fixed shaft, and the inclination angle sensor (51) is embedded in the outer wall of the rotating plate (5).
6. The cooling device for fried instant wonton processing according to claim 1, characterized in that the linkage rod (7) is fixed on the side wall of the floating block (6) through a key pin, and the linkage rod (7) is connected and fixed with the side wall of the rotating plate (5) through a key pin.
7. The cooling device for fried instant wonton processing according to claim 1, characterized in that the indicator light is connected with the inclination sensor (51) through an electric signal.
